TRIMIX DIVER
A COMPREHENSIVE TRAINING

 

 

This course offers comprehensive training for divers who wish to use gas mixtures containing helium, EAN (Enriched Air Nitrox), or pure oxygen, with the goal of conducting safe dives up to a maximum depth of 60 meters. The primary focus of the course is on the use of Trimix mixtures, a combination of oxygen, nitrogen, and helium, which is particularly useful for reducing the narcotic effects of nitrogen during deep dives. Students will acquire all the necessary skills to plan and conduct dives with Trimix, learning to manage both depth and the associated decompression times safely.

Throughout the course, divers will be trained to effectively use specific equipment for these types of dives, such as multiple cylinders and advanced dive computers designed to handle different gas mixtures. The theoretical lessons will cover essential topics such as the physiology of breathing with Trimix, dive planning and decompression stops, as well as emergency management during deep dives.

Upon completion of the course, divers who obtain certification will be authorized to perform dives using Trimix mixtures without the need for supervision, provided that the training conditions are respected. This means they will be able to dive independently while maintaining an oxygen percentage in the mixture no lower than 18%, as established by the course guidelines to ensure safety.
